Blanket designed and woven by Llio James, entitled: 'Llwyd, Siarcol, Du'. Handwoven in lambswool (92%), silk (6%) and cotton (2%) with an abstract design in grey, charcoal and black.
Rectangular blanket, twill weave, made with black, grey and white yarns which are used to create an irregular geometrical pattern of horizontal and vertical stripes of black and different shades of grey (achieved by different combinations of black and grey). Edges are finished with double-turnbacks which are machine stitched using black thread.
